Description
This BM2 Motor rated at 15.8 GPM, 240 RPM, 1595 PSI, and 3403 LBS-IN, has a 250 CC displacement, 1-1/4” Tapered Shaft, SAE-10 Port Size, Wheel Motor Flange, and in-line port configuration. The BM2 series hydraulic motor is a medium-volume, spool valve-type motor with an optional side load-bearing design. Available in H series Eaton and S series Danfoss ports. High-pressure shaft seals up to 2,900 PSI available. The BM2W series wheel motor has a recessed mounting flange with a radial bearing design, which can bear a more significant load. High-pressure shaft seals up to 2,900 PSI are available.
- Utilizes the hydraulic geroler motor design
- Higher efficiency than the BM1 motor series
- Shaft seal designed to bear higher pressures
- Can be used in series or parallel hydraulic circuit applications
- Shaft speed is easily controlled and operates smoothly
- Offers the best efficiency and economy in medium-load applications
- Standard shaft seals are rated at 1,987 PSI
- High-pressure shaft seals available up to 2,900 PSI
